WebDhutangas are a specific list of thirteen practices, four of which pertain to food: eating once a day, eating at one sitting, reducing the amount you eat, on alms-round, eating only the food that you receive at the first seven houses. Hi Bunks, in Thailand, most Theravada monks have two meals a day up until noon time. Having one meal a day is considered as an ascetic practice (dhatunga) and is the norm mostly for the monks in the forest tradition.
